Abstract

The utility model provides a curved surface polishing device for a circular metal piece, which comprises a workbench, wherein the top end in the workbench is fixedly connected with a fixed part of a driving device, a movable part of the driving device extends out of the upper side of the workbench and is fixedly connected with a collecting cylinder, the collecting cylinder is positioned on the left side of a moving mechanism, the middle position of the bottom end in the collecting cylinder is fixedly connected with a conical guide column which is arranged in a small and big way, the middle position of the upper end of the conical guide column is fixedly connected with a clamping component for clamping a circular metal pipe fitting, and the clamping component extends out of the upper side of the collecting cylinder, the driving device is utilized to drive the collecting cylinder to rotate so as to carry out polishing treatment, and scraps generated by polishing can be collected in the collecting cylinder, and are guided to the edge position of the bottom end in the collecting cylinder under the action of the conical guide column and centrifugal force so as to facilitate subsequent cleaning operation, effectively avoids the scraps from falling at will and has good environmental protection.

Detailed Description
In order to make the technical means, the creation characteristics, the achievement purposes and the effects of the utility model easy to understand, the utility model is further described with the specific embodiments.
Referring to fig. 1-4, the present invention provides a technical solution: a curved surface polishing device for a circular metal piece comprises a workbench 1, a moving mechanism 6 installed at the upper end of the workbench 1 and a polishing main body 5 fixed at the upper end of a movable part of the moving mechanism 6, wherein the moving mechanism 6 and the polishing main body 5 are in the prior art, the top end inside the workbench 1 is fixedly connected with a fixed part of a driving device, a collecting cylinder 3 is driven to rotate through the driving device, the driving device can adopt a motor 7, the movable part of the driving device extends out of the upper side of the workbench 1 and is fixedly connected with the collecting cylinder 3, the collecting cylinder 3 is positioned at the left side of the moving mechanism 6, on one hand, scraps generated by polishing are collected through the collecting cylinder 3, on the other hand, an installation carrier is provided for a conical guide column 2, a plurality of moving components which are arranged in a circular shape are fixed at equal intervals at the lower end of the collecting cylinder 3, the moving components are connected to the upper end of the workbench 1 in a rolling manner and are used for assisting the rotation of the collecting cylinder 3 through the moving components, the movable component can adopt a miniature universal ball, the middle position of the bottom end in the collecting cylinder 3 is fixedly connected with the conical guide post 2 which is arranged in a large-size manner from top to bottom, and on one hand, the conical guide post 2 provides a mounting carrier for the circular shell 41 and on the other hand, collected waste scraps can be guided.

Specifically, the circular metal pipe can be sleeved outside the circular shell 41, at this time, the arc-shaped clamping plate 42 is located in the circular metal pipe, then the bidirectional screw 47 is rotated, and due to the fact that the bidirectional screw 47 is in threaded connection with the first nut seat 44 and the second nut seat 45, the bidirectional screw 47 rotates, the first nut seat 44 and the second nut seat 45 move in a phase, and under the action of the first support arm 43 and the second support arm 46, the arc-shaped clamping plate 42 moves outwards, so that the circular metal pipe is stably clamped, the verticality of installation of the circular metal pipe is guaranteed, and the subsequent polishing quality is improved.
